H4864
מַשְׂאֹת
mas'ot
Pronunciation: mas-ayth'
Definition
properly, (abstractly) a raising (as of the hands in prayer), or rising (of flame); figuratively, an utterance; concretely, a beacon (as raised); a present (as taken), mess, or tribute; figuratively, a reproach (as a burden)
KJV Renderings
burden, collection, sign of fire, (great) flame, gift, lifting up, mess, oblation, reward.
